1. Cape Kri
One of the most iconic dive sites in Raja Ampat, Cape Kri boasts an impressive record of over 374 species of fish. The site features a remarkable reef system that drops to a depth of around 30 meters (100 feet). Divers can encounter everything from schools of barracuda to manta rays. Accessing Cape Kri is typically possible throughout the year, but the best conditions can be found from October to April, when visibility can exceed 30 meters (100 feet).
2. Blue Magic
Blue Magic is another highlight that should not be missed. This site features a submerged reef that attracts a variety of pelagic species. The dive conditions here are generally excellent, with an average depth of 20-40 meters (66-131 feet). The best time to dive Blue Magic is during the months of October to April when the currents are favorable and marine life is abundant. Expect to see large schools of fish and, occasionally, the majestic Mola Mola. Keep in mind that this site can experience strong currents, so it’s best suited for intermediate to advanced divers.
3. Misool Dive Sites
Misool, one of the four main islands in Raja Ampat, offers a wealth of dive sites perfect for a private charter experience. Notable locations such as Boo Rock and Nudi Rock are famous for their rich biodiversity and stunning coral formations. The depths here range from 5 to 40 meters (16-131 feet), catering to a variety of diving experiences. Misool sees its peak season from October to April, where conditions are calm and visibility is at its best. Expect to come across a vibrant marine ecosystem featuring everything from small critters to larger pelagics.
4. Manta Sandy
If you dream of swimming alongside manta rays, Manta Sandy is the site for you. This dive spot is famous for its cleaning stations where mantas come to be groomed by smaller fish. The diving season here is best from March to December, with peak sightings typically occurring from April to June. The depth at Manta Sandy ranges from 10 to 30 meters (33-100 feet), making it accessible for both novice and experienced divers. In addition to mantas, divers can also encounter a variety of tropical fish and vibrant coral reefs.
Advanced Drift Dives in Raja Ampat
For experienced divers seeking an adrenaline rush, Raja Ampat offers exhilarating drift dives. One of the top spots for this is the current-rich site of Chicken Reef. Here, divers can enjoy the thrill of being carried along by the currents while observing large schools of fish and vibrant coral gardens. These dives are generally conducted at depths of 15-30 meters (50-100 feet), and the best time for drift diving is from October to April when conditions are most favorable.
Easy Snorkel Spots for Families
Raja Ampat isn’t just for advanced divers; families can also enjoy this aquatic paradise. Several easy snorkel spots are accessible from a private yacht including Sawandarek Village and Arborek Island. These locations feature shallow waters, making them ideal for children and novice snorkelers. Expect to see colorful fish and beautiful coral gardens at depths generally ranging from 1 to 5 meters (3-16 feet). The best months for family-friendly snorkeling are typically from October to April, coinciding with the calmest waters.
Night Diving in Raja Ampat
For those looking to experience the underwater world after dark, night diving in Raja Ampat can be a mesmerizing adventure. Popular night dive sites include Cape Kri and the reefs around Misool. Night dives typically showcase an entirely different array of marine life, including nocturnal creatures that are rarely seen during the day. Gear rental and guided night dive tours are often available through your yacht charter. Night dives can be safely performed at depths of 10-30 meters (33-100 feet), with the best conditions often found from October to December.
Planning Your Yacht Charter: Costs and Logistics
When planning your private yacht charter in Raja Ampat, understanding the costs involved can help streamline your experience. A typical yacht charter ranges from $1,500 to $5,000 per day, depending on the size and luxury of the vessel, with most charters available for either a 3-day or week-long itinerary. Additional costs include diving packages, which typically range from $50 to $100 per dive, depending on whether you require gear rental. Be sure to factor in local fees and tips for crew members, which can add another $200-300 to your overall budget.
